do our factory anti-theft sound when lock/unlock?

i am just wondering if my anti-theft is supposed to honk when locked and unlocked? i know alot of cars do, but i was reading my owners manual and i didnt find anything. to get it out the way yes my horn works, it sounds if you press panic, and its fully functional(locks and unlocks, rolls the front windows)

ok and question two(this i didnt search for so feel free to flame if theres an answer here) What is necessary to make the back windows roll down like the front ones with the remote?

edit: i have a 95 SE

The horn does not honk...the hazards flash twice instead.

There is no way to get the rear windows to roll down using the OEM key fob.

Windows

If you want your windows to go up and down by remote, my best suggestion would be go to pepboys and pick up this box - it's only 20$ and has 4 buttons on the remote with four different switches. You can program how the switches work too. For power windows to work with it, you'll just need to get a 2 relays(one for the up button and one for the down button) for all the windows at once or 2 at a time, or you can get 4 relays one to control the front up and down and one for the rear up and down.
